yes, you need to ask interFoam to use p_rgh as the temperature name. It should then use that as a pressure field:

You can do that by adding nameP in your preciceDict, similar to these instructions: Configure the OpenFOAM adapter | preCICE - The Coupling Library

I realized we have not yet documented this option, but you can find out the exact option by looking at this part of the code:
